我目前在延期频道上使用word 2016,在office.js文件中使用制作CDN。
我很难找到对表支持进行运行时检查的正确方法。
Office.context.requirements.isSetSupported('WordApi',1.1)返回true; Office.context.requirements.isSetSupported('WordApi',1.3)返回false;
然而,我对表集合所做的所有交互都运行得很好。有没有更好的方法来进行运行时检查?我需要优雅地处理表不可用的情况,并且没有看到这样做的好方法。
在不支持表格的环境中: var tables = context.document.body.tables; 上面的表定义了var。它只是负载错误。
答案 0 :(得分:2)
检查它的正确方法是Office.context.requirements.isSetSupported('WordApi',1.3)。所有表格功能都在1.3
中现在我们处于将库从预览移动到生产的过渡过程中,这就是它工作的原因,但可能不支持某些功能。所以我强烈建议你相信isSetSupported方法。
感谢。